Active ingredientPurpose
Zinc Oxide 14%Skin protectant
Uses Helps treat and prevent diaper rash. Protects chafed skin due to diaper rash and helps seal out wetness.
Warnings
For external use only.
When using this productdo not get into eyes.
Stop use and ask a doctor if condition worsens or symptoms last more than 7 days or clear up and occur again within a few days.
Keep out of reach of children. If swallowed get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center immediately.
Directions
Change wet and soiled diapers promptly, cleanse the diaper area, and allow to dry.
Apply diaper rash cream liberally as often as necessary to prevent or treat irritation, with each diaper change, and especially at bedtime or anytime when exposure to wet diapers may be prolonged..
Other information Will stain clothing. Store at room temperature.
